Abstract

An access control device controls access to a first device and a second device. The first device is connected with a first bus conforming to a first standard and conforms to the first standard. The second device is connected with the first bus and conforms to a second standard. The access control device includes a first signal generator and a second signal generator. The first signal generator generates a first transaction start signal indicating start of a transaction for the first device. The second signal generator generates a second transaction start signal for the second device based on the first transaction start signal.

Claims (25)

1. An access control device for controlling access to a first device connected with a first bus conforming to a first standard, said first device conforming to said first standard and access to a second device connected with said first bus, said second device conforming to a second standard, said access control device comprising:

a first signal generator which generates a first transaction start signal indicating start of a transaction for said first device; and

a second signal generator which generates a second transaction start signal for said second device based on said first transaction start signal,

wherein the first signal generator generating the first transaction start signal and the second signal generator generating the second transaction start signal are adapted to and result in the first device communicating with the second device without employing a first standard-second standard bridge even though the first device conforms to the first standard and the second device conforms to the second standard, the second standard being different than the first standard, where otherwise the first device is unable to communicate with the second device due to the second standard being different than the first standard.

2. The access control device according to claim 1 , wherein said second signal generator generates said second transaction start signal upon occurrence of an access to said second device.

3. The access control device according to claim 1 , wherein said second signal generator suspends generating said second transaction start signal upon occurrence of an access to said first device.

4. The access control device according to claim 1 , wherein said second signal generator includes an address judgment unit which judges whether or not an address of a device to be accessed accords with an address of said second device and a gate unit which can generate said second transaction start signal based on said first transaction start signal and a judgment of said address judgment unit and can outputs said second transaction start signal to said second device.

5. The access control device according to claim 1 , wherein said first bus is a PCI (Peripheral Component Interconnect) bus.

6. The access control device according to claim 5 , wherein said first transaction start signal is a first FRAME signal.

7. The access control device according to claim 6 , wherein said second signal generator judges whether or not an address stored in a CONFIG ADDRESS register accords with an address of said second device and can generate a second FRAME signal for said second device based on said first FRAME signal and a judgment thereof.

8. The access control device according to claim 1 , wherein a plurality of said second devices are connected with said first bus, and said second signal generator generates said second transaction start signal for a second device to be accessed in said plurality of second devices.

9. The access control device according to claim 8 , wherein said second signal generator includes an address judgment unit which judges whether or not an address of a device to be accessed accords with an address of each of said plurality of second devices and a gate unit which can generate said second transaction start signal for said second device to be accessed based on said first transaction start signal and a judgment of said address judgment unit and can output said second transaction start signal to said second device.

10. An access control method for controlling an access to a second device conforming to a second standard, said second device being connected with a first bus conforming to a first standard, the method comprising:

generating a first transaction start signal for a first device conforming to said first standard and connecting with said first bus; and

generating a second transaction start signal for said second device based on said first transaction start signal,

wherein generating the first transaction start signal and generating the second transaction start signal are adapted to and result in the first device communicating with the second device without employing a first standard-second standard bridge even though the first device conforms to the first standard and the second device conforms to the second standard, the second standard being different than the first standard, where otherwise the first device is unable to communicate with the second device due to the second standard being different than the first standard.

11. The access control method according to claim 10 , wherein said second transaction start signal is generated upon occurrence of an access to said second device.

12. The access control method according to claim 10 , wherein generation of said second transaction start signal is suspended upon occurrence of an access to said first device.

13. The access control method according to claim 10 , wherein said generating a second transaction start signal includes judging whether or not an address of a device to be accessed accords with an address of said second device, generating said second transaction start signal based on said first transaction start signal and matching of said addresses, and outputting said second transaction start signal to said second device.

14. The access control method according to claim 10 , wherein said first bus is a PCI (Peripheral Component Interconnect) bus.

15. The access control method according to claim 14 , wherein said first transaction start signal is a first FRAME signal.

16. The access control method according to claim 15 , wherein said generating a second transaction start signal includes judging whether or not an address stored in a CONFIG ADDRESS register accords with an address of said second device and generating a second FRAME signal for said second device based on said first FRAME signal and matching of said addresses.

17. The access control method according to claim 10 , wherein a plurality of said second devices are connected with said first bus, and said second transaction start signal for a second device to be accessed in said plurality of second devices is generated.

18. The access control method according to claim 10 , wherein a plurality of said second devices are connected with said first bus, and

said generating a second transaction start signal includes judging whether or not an address of a device to be accessed accords with an address of each of said plurality of second devices, generating said second transaction start signal for said second device to be accessed based on said first transaction start signal and matching of said addresses, and outputting said second transaction start signal to said second device.
